Winner of 1992 Golden Cine Film Award. This incredible action-packed video
takes you to some of the most exotic locations in the world. You'll see
brilliantly photographed heli-skiing at the Caribous, British Columbia,
Canada; cliff diving at Chamonix, France; sailboarding at The Gorge, Portland,
Oregon; bungee jumping at Auckland, New Zealand; surfing the Pipeline, Maui,
Hawaii, off road racing at the Great Mojave Desert, Nevada and extreme kayaking
at the Grand Canyon in Arizona.

View the new edge of in-line skating through Vertical Axis - a skate film.
This film captures the fun and spirit of in-line skating, profiles the skaters
new mood, attitude and dedication to their sport as a lifestyle, not just
a passing fad. It's an in-depth look at the tricks, moves grooves and techniques
used in skating. Witness in-line Skate Master Chris Edwards, Bad-Boy Pat
Parnell, Poster Man Chris Mitchell, The Man Down Under Alan Vano, Little
Devil Arlo Esienberg, Grasshopper Jimmy Trimble and Crazy ... Splatmaster
Brook Howard-Smith as they give you a 50-minute All-Axis pass to the edge
of in-line skating.

Get ready for adrenaline pumping action as we join Warren Miller in his latest video and see big "D" class
catamarans powering along at over 30 mph, the spectacular "C" class wingmasterd cats, Olympic class Tornadoes,
windsurfing taught by its inventor - and much, much, more. The ships of the world and the champions that sail them are
the stars of this action-packed tribute to the thrilling spectacle that is High Performance Sailing!
